Mysql
 sql >> Teknologi Basis Data >  >> RDS >> Mysql

Bagaimana saya bisa melihat isi dari pernyataan yang disiapkan?

Menggunakan pernyataan yang telah disiapkan:

  • Saat Anda menyiapkan pernyataan, pernyataan itu dikirim ke server MySQL
  • Saat Anda mengikat variabel + mengeksekusi pernyataan, hanya variabel yang dikirim ke server MySQL
  • Dan pernyataan + variabel terikat dieksekusi di server MySQL -- tanpa melakukan "persiapan" ulang setiap kali pernyataan dieksekusi (itulah sebabnya pernyataan yang disiapkan bisa bagus untuk kinerja ketika pernyataan yang sama dieksekusi beberapa kali)

Tidak ada "pembuatan" kueri SQL di sisi PHP, jadi, tidak ada cara untuk benar-benar mendapatkan kueri itu.

Artinya, jika Anda ingin melihat kueri SQL, Anda harus menggunakan kueri SQL, dan bukan pernyataan yang disiapkan.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ara efisien untuk mensimulasikan gabungan luar penuh di MySQL?

  2. Apa kinerja terbaik untuk Mengambil hasil MySQL EAV sebagai Tabel Relasional?

  3. Cara melewati baris saat mengimpor dump MySQL yang buruk

  4. 1064 kesalahan dalam CREATE TABLE ... TYPE=MYISAM

  5. Mengoptimalkan ORDER BY